commit | a3e008abc51933d567303a1b4bd17e68c798f60e | [log] [tgz] |
---|---|---|
author | Chris Lattner <sabre@nondot.org> | Mon Dec 14 05:00:18 2009 +0000 |
committer | Chris Lattner <sabre@nondot.org> | Mon Dec 14 05:00:18 2009 +0000 |
tree | c9b74d5cb4480367e0b4ba316ccc90941e8b027c | |
parent | 0dcfbc5879694debfa83520ec09635d51afdf9de [diff] |
fix rdar://7466570 - Be more bug compatible with GCC when it comes to expanding directives withing macro expansions. This is undefined behavior according to 6.10.3p11, so we might as well be undefined in ways similar to GCC. git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@91266 91177308-0d34-0410-b5e6-96231b3b80d8